Unlocking the Cybersecurity Secrets of Modern Vehicles

March 13, 17:00 (CAMPUS)

This talk explores the cybersecurity challenges of modern vehicles, focusing on potential attack surfaces such as remote control risks. I will also share some key insights gained from our research into vehicle security.

Speaker

YUQIAO NING

YUQIAO NING is the Technical Director of CATARC Automotive Data of China Co., Ltd. He has extensive experience in computer systems and software security research. In his current role, he is primarily responsible for pioneering research in automotive penetration technology and the development of automated detection tools. His work focuses on analyzing security risks within automotive open-source software, with a particular emphasis on understanding the critical intersection of automotive security vulnerabilities and functional safety. He has played a pivotal role in organizing numerous automotive information security attack and defense challenges, contributing significantly to the advancement of safer and more secure automotive technologies. Furthermore, He has played an instrumental role in shaping national automotive information security standards, contributing to the drafting of several key national standards.
